Every student in Maine deserves an honest, complete education—one that reflects the full story of our state and country.

LD 957 ensures that Asian American, Native Hawaiian, and Pacific Islander (AANHPI) history is part of what students learn. It’s a practical, respectful step that supports accurate education, safer communities, and a stronger future for all of us.
